Why did they stop making Lincoln Continental?

Lincoln is stopping production of the Continental at the end of this year. The company says the decision is due to declining sales of full-size premium sedans. With the Lincoln MKZ and Conti both heading for the graveyard, that will leave the luxury automaker with an all-SUV lineup for the first time ever.

What car replaced the Lincoln Continental?

From 1949 to 1955, the nameplate was briefly retired. In 1981, the Continental was renamed the Lincoln Town Car to accommodate the 1982 seventh-generation Continental. After 2002, the Continental was retired, largely replaced by the Lincoln MKS in 2009; in 2017, the tenth-generation Continental replaced the MKS.

Does Lincoln make any cars anymore?

Like several automotive brands, Lincoln has phased out all of its traditional passenger cars in recent years and now offers only SUVs. The lineup includes the compact Corsair, mid-size Nautilus, three-row mid-size Aviator and full-size Navigator.
